12 Jyotirlingas in India With Map

12 Jyotirlingas in India with Map – Names, Location, Story & Complete Travel Guide (2025)

12 Jyotirlingas in India with Map – Complete Travel Guide (2025)

India, the land of spirituality, is home to countless temples, each holding a special significance in Hindu mythology. But among them, the 12 Jyotirlingas of Lord Shiva hold the highest reverence. These sacred shrines represent the places where Lord Shiva appeared as a column of light — a symbol of infinite power and purity.

Table of Contents

Jyoti” means light, and “Linga” means symbol, and together, Jyotirlinga means “the radiant symbol of Shiva.” Each Jyotirlinga represents a different manifestation of Lord Shiva and tells a story of his divine play (Leela) on Earth.

Visiting all 12 Jyotirlingas, spread across India, is considered one of the holiest pilgrimages — known as the Dwadasa Jyotirlinga Yatra. In this detailed guide, we’ll explore every Jyotirlinga’s legend, location, temple architecture, best time to visit, and travel tips — along with a map of all 12 Jyotirlingas in India.


🗺️ 12 Jyotirlingas in India With Map

12 Jyotirlingas in India Map

List of the 12 Jyotirlingas:

  1. Somnath – Gujarat
  2. Mallikarjuna – Andhra Pradesh
  3. Mahakaleshwar – Madhya Pradesh
  4. Omkareshwar – Madhya Pradesh
  5. Kedarnath – Uttarakhand
  6. Bhimashankar – Maharashtra
  7. Kashi Vishwanath – Uttar Pradesh
  8. Trimbakeshwar – Maharashtra
  9. Vaidyanath – Jharkhand
  10. Nageshwar – Gujarat
  11. Rameshwaram – Tamil Nadu
  12. Grishneshwar – Maharashtra

🌅 1. Somnath Jyotirlinga, Gujarat

Somnath Jyotirlinga

📍 Location: Prabhas Patan, near Veraval, Saurashtra Coast

Somnath Jyotirlinga is the first and most sacred among the twelve. Known as “The Shrine Eternal”, it has been destroyed and rebuilt several times, symbolizing the indestructible spirit of faith.

📜 Legend:

As per the Shiva Purana, the moon god Chandra married 27 daughters of Daksha Prajapati. However, he favored only Rohini, which angered Daksha. He cursed Chandra to lose his radiance. Seeking help, Chandra worshipped Lord Shiva at Prabhas Patan, who restored his glow and resided here as Somnath (Lord of the Moon).

🛕 Architecture & Importance:

The temple stands magnificently on the Arabian Sea’s edge, with waves continuously touching its base — a sight that fills the heart with divinity. The current structure, rebuilt in Chalukya style, represents a blend of spirituality and artistic excellence.

🌤️ Best Time to Visit:

October to March (cool coastal weather). Avoid monsoons.

🧭 Travel Tip:

Nearest airport – Diu (65 km). Stay in Somnath town or Veraval. Visit nearby Bhalka Tirth and Triveni Sangam.


🌄 2. Mallikarjuna Jyotirlinga, Andhra Pradesh

Mallikarjuna Jyotirlinga

📍 Location: Srisailam, Kurnool District

Situated atop the Nallamala Hills, Mallikarjuna is both a Jyotirlinga and a Shakti Peetha. It is one of the few temples where Shiva and Parvati are worshipped together as Mallikarjuna and Bhramaramba Devi.

📜 Legend:

When Lord Kartikeya, upset after a family misunderstanding, moved away from Kailash, his parents, Shiva and Parvati, followed him to Srisailam. Their presence turned the place sacred.

🏛️ Architecture & Experience:

The temple is surrounded by dense forests and the River Krishna. The stone carvings, ancient pillars, and vibrant lamps create an atmosphere of serenity.

🌤️ Best Time to Visit:

October to February.

🧭 Travel Tip:

Stay at Srisailam. Don’t miss the scenic ghat roads, and visit the Sakshi Ganapati Temple nearby.


🌅 3. Mahakaleshwar Jyotirlinga, Madhya Pradesh

Mahakaleshwar Jyotirlinga

📍 Location: Ujjain, on the banks of the River Shipra

The Mahakaleshwar Temple is one of the most powerful Jyotirlingas. Here, Shiva is worshipped as Mahakal, the Lord of Time and Death. It is the only South-facing Jyotirlinga, which symbolizes Shiva’s control over life and death.

📜 Legend:

In ancient times, a demon named Dushan tormented the city of Avanti (now Ujjain). When devotees cried for help, Lord Shiva emerged as Mahakal and destroyed the demon, choosing to stay here as a protector deity.

🌅 Bhasma Aarti:

The Bhasma Aarti performed at 4 a.m. using sacred ash is world-famous. It’s believed that attending it removes all sins and grants liberation.

🌤️ Best Time to Visit:

October to March.

🧭 Travel Tip:

Reach Ujjain via Indore airport (50 km). Visit Ram Ghat, Harsiddhi Temple, and Kal Bhairav Temple nearby.


🌊 4. Omkareshwar Jyotirlinga, Madhya Pradesh

Omkareshwar Jyotirlinga

📍 Location: Island on River Narmada

Omkareshwar gets its name because the island on which the temple stands is naturally shaped like “ॐ” (Om), the sacred symbol of Hinduism. The sound of river waves and temple bells makes it a truly divine place.

📜 Legend:

Once, the Devas prayed to Shiva to defeat the demon Tripurasura. Pleased, Shiva manifested as Omkareshwar and blessed the land.

🏛️ Temple Architecture:

Built in Nagara style, the temple has beautiful carvings and offers a peaceful view of the Narmada River from its steps.

🌤️ Best Time to Visit:

October to February.

🧭 Travel Tip:

Nearest city – Indore (80 km). Take a boat ride to the island for a scenic view of Omkareshwar.


🏔️ 5. Kedarnath Jyotirlinga, Uttarakhand

Kedarnath Jyotirlinga

📍 Location: Garhwal Himalayas, near Mandakini River

Kedarnath is one of the most revered pilgrimage sites in India, part of both the Char Dham and Panch Kedar yatras. The temple sits at 3,583 meters, surrounded by snow-clad peaks and deep devotion.

📜 Legend:

After the Mahabharata war, the Pandavas sought Shiva’s forgiveness for their sins. Shiva disguised himself as a bull and vanished underground; his hump appeared in Kedarnath, forming the Jyotirlinga.

🏛️ Temple Architecture:

Made of massive stone slabs, it has withstood floods, earthquakes, and time itself. The aura of Kedarnath is indescribable — silence, devotion, and nature merge into one.

🌤️ Best Time to Visit:

May to October (Closed in winter due to heavy snow).

🧭 Travel Tip:

Trek from Gaurikund (16 km). Helicopter services are available from Phata and Guptkashi.


🌳 6. Bhimashankar Jyotirlinga, Maharashtra

Bhimashankar Jyotirlinga

📍 Location: Sahyadri Hills near Pune

Surrounded by lush greenery and wildlife, Bhimashankar is both a spiritual and natural paradise. It is also the source of the River Bhima.

📜 Legend:

Lord Shiva appeared here as Bhimashankar to defeat the demon Tripurasura, who terrorized the heavens.

🏞️ Temple Architecture:

The Nagara-style temple with intricate carvings and peaceful surroundings attracts devotees and trekkers alike.

🌤️ Best Time to Visit:

October to March.

🧭 Travel Tip:

From Pune (110 km), drive through scenic ghats. Visit Hanuman Lake and Bhimashankar Wildlife Sanctuary nearby.


🌆 7. Kashi Vishwanath Jyotirlinga, Uttar Pradesh

Kashi Vishwanath Jyotirlinga

📍 Location: Varanasi

The Kashi Vishwanath Temple on the banks of the River Ganga is one of the most sacred temples in India. A visit here is believed to grant Moksha (liberation).

📜 Legend:

When Lord Vishnu and Brahma argued about supremacy, Shiva appeared as an endless pillar of fire — the Jyotirlinga. The place where it emerged became Varanasi, the city of Shiva.

🏛️ Importance:

The temple’s golden spire and spiritual energy attract millions of pilgrims. Lord Shiva himself whispers the Taraka mantra to dying souls here.

🌤️ Best Time to Visit:

November to March.

🧭 Travel Tip:

Visit Ganga Aarti at Dashashwamedh Ghat. Stay near the old city for a full experience of Kashi’s divine energy.


🌾 8. Trimbakeshwar Jyotirlinga, Maharashtra

Trimbakeshwar Jyotirlinga

📍 Location: Nashik District

This temple marks the origin of the Godavari River. It’s an important place for performing ancestral rituals (Pind Daan).

📜 Legend:

Gautama Rishi’s penance brought the Ganga River to earth from here.

🏛️ Temple Features:

Trimbakeshwar is unique because the Linga has three faces symbolizing Brahma, Vishnu, and Mahesh (Shiva).

🌤️ Best Time to Visit:

October to February.

🧭 Travel Tip:

Visit the nearby Brahmagiri hills and Kushavarta Kund — the origin of the Godavari River.


🌸 9. Vaidyanath Jyotirlinga, Jharkhand

Vaidyanath Jyotirlinga

📍 Location: Deoghar

Vaidyanath or Baba Baidyanath Dham is one of the most powerful Jyotirlingas, known for healing and health blessings.

📜 Legend:

Ravana worshipped Lord Shiva here, offering his ten heads. Pleased by his devotion, Shiva restored him and became known as Vaidyanath (the Divine Healer).

🏛️ Significance:

It is believed that anyone who worships this Jyotirlinga with a pure heart is freed from diseases and sins.

🌤️ Best Time to Visit:

October to March.

🧭 Travel Tip:

Reach via Jasidih railway station (8 km). Don’t miss the Shravan Mela held in July–August.


🌊 10. Nageshwar Jyotirlinga, Gujarat

Nageshwar Jyotirlinga

📍 Location: Dwarka

Nageshwar Temple lies near the Arabian Sea, symbolizing Shiva as the protector from poison and evil forces.

📜 Legend:

A devotee named Supriya was captured by a demon named Daruka. She prayed to Shiva, who appeared, killed the demon, and established himself here as Nageshwar.

🏛️ Temple Features:

A giant 25-meter statue of Lord Shiva and a serene seaside environment make it a spiritually uplifting experience.

🌤️ Best Time to Visit:

October to February.

🧭 Travel Tip:

Visit Dwarkadhish Temple and Bet Dwarka Island nearby.


🌴 11. Rameshwaram Jyotirlinga, Tamil Nadu

Rameshwaram Jyotirlinga

📍 Location: Rameswaram Island

One of the Char Dham sites, Rameshwaram, is deeply connected to the Ramayana.

📜 Legend:

Before crossing to Lanka, Lord Rama built a Shiva Linga from sand and prayed for forgiveness after killing Ravana.

🏛️ Temple Architecture:

Famous for its longest corridor in the world (1,200 meters) and stunning Dravidian architecture. The temple has 22 holy wells for purification rituals.

🌤️ Best Time to Visit:

October to April.

🧭 Travel Tip:

Visit Dhanushkodi beach and Ram Setu viewpoint nearby.


🌼 12. Grishneshwar Jyotirlinga, Maharashtra

📍 Location: Ellora, near Aurangabad

The last Jyotirlinga, Grishneshwar, is near the famous Ellora Caves, a UNESCO World Heritage Site.

📜 Legend:

A devoted woman, Kusuma, worshipped a Shiva Linga daily. When her son was killed, she continued her devotion. Impressed by her faith, Lord Shiva revived her son and manifested as Grishneshwar.

🏛️ Temple Highlights:

The temple’s red-stone carvings, intricate sculptures, and spiritual ambiance make it a must-visit site.

🌤️ Best Time to Visit:

October to March.

🧭 Travel Tip:

Visit nearby Ellora and Ajanta Caves for a divine and historical experience.


✨ Spiritual Meaning of the 12 Jyotirlingas

Each Jyotirlinga represents a specific aspect of Shiva — from creation to destruction, from compassion to justice. Together, they represent the complete cosmic energy of Mahadev.

Visiting all 12 Jyotirlingas is said to cleanse the soul, remove karmic sins, and grant Moksha.


🧭 Suggested 12 Jyotirlinga Yatra Route

  1. Somnath – Gujarat
  2. Nageshwar – Gujarat
  3. Trimbakeshwar – Maharashtra
  4. Bhimashankar – Maharashtra
  5. Grishneshwar – Maharashtra
  6. Omkareshwar – Madhya Pradesh
  7. Mahakaleshwar – Madhya Pradesh
  8. Vaidyanath – Jharkhand
  9. Kashi Vishwanath – Uttar Pradesh
  10. Kedarnath – Uttarakhand
  11. Mallikarjuna – Andhra Pradesh
  12. Rameshwaram – Tamil Nadu

🕉️ FAQs About 12 Jyotirlingas

Q1. How many Jyotirlingas are in India?
There are 12 sacred Jyotirlingas spread across India.

Q2. What is the meaning of Jyotirlinga?
It means “Radiant Symbol of Lord Shiva.”

Q3. Which is the most important Jyotirlinga?
All are divine, but Somnath, Kashi Vishwanath, and Kedarnath are among the most visited.

Q4. Can all 12 be visited in one trip?
Yes. Many travel agencies organize 12 Jyotirlinga Yatra packages by air and road.

Q5. What is the benefit of visiting Jyotirlingas?
It is believed to purify the soul, grant peace, and fulfill desires.


🌺 Conclusion

The 12 Jyotirlingas of India are not just temples; they are spiritual powerhouses where the divine presence of Lord Shiva is felt deeply. Each shrine has its own energy, story, and lesson — reminding us that divinity exists in every direction of this vast land.

If you’re planning your next pilgrimage, start your journey with Somnath Jyotirlinga or Kedarnath, and let Mahadev’s blessings guide your path.

Har Har Mahadev! 🔱

3 Comments

Leave a Reply

Your email address will not be published. Required fields are marked *